Submission #71700574


Source Code Expand

#include <iostream>
#include <algorithm>
using namespace std;
#define int long long

const int N = 5e5 + 5;
int a[N];
int pos[N];

signed main()
{
	int n;
	cin >> n;
	for(int i = 1;i <= n;i++)
	{
		cin >> a[i];
		pos[a[i]] = i;
	}
	int l = n + 1,r = 0;
	long long ans = n * (n + 1) / 2 + n;
	for(int i = 1;i <= n;i++) 
	{
		l = min(l,pos[i]);
		r = max(r,pos[i]);
		if(r - l + 1 == i) ans--;
	}
	cout << ans << endl;
	return 0;
}

Submission Info

Submission Time
Task F - Starry Landscape Photo
User rgr2025
Language C++23 (GCC 15.2.0)
Score 0
Code Size 457 Byte
Status WA
Exec Time 101 ms
Memory 11452 KiB

Judge Result

Set Name Sample All
Score / Max Score 0 / 0 0 / 500
Status
AC × 2
WA × 1
AC × 18
WA × 24
Set Name Test Cases
Sample 00_sample_00.txt, 00_sample_01.txt, 00_sample_02.txt
All 00_sample_00.txt, 00_sample_01.txt, 00_sample_02.txt, 01_random_03.txt, 01_random_04.txt, 01_random_05.txt, 01_random_06.txt, 01_random_07.txt, 01_random_08.txt, 01_random_09.txt, 01_random_10.txt, 01_random_11.txt, 01_random_12.txt, 01_random_13.txt, 01_random_14.txt, 01_random_15.txt, 01_random_16.txt, 01_random_17.txt, 01_random_18.txt, 01_random_19.txt, 01_random_20.txt, 01_random_21.txt, 01_random_22.txt, 01_random_23.txt, 01_random_24.txt, 01_random_25.txt, 01_random_26.txt, 01_random_27.txt, 01_random_28.txt, 01_random_29.txt, 01_random_30.txt, 01_random_31.txt, 01_random_32.txt, 01_random_33.txt, 01_random_34.txt, 01_random_35.txt, 01_random_36.txt, 01_random_37.txt, 01_random_38.txt, 01_random_39.txt, 01_random_40.txt, 01_random_41.txt
Case Name Status Exec Time Memory
00_sample_00.txt AC 2 ms 3452 KiB
00_sample_01.txt AC 1 ms 3348 KiB
00_sample_02.txt WA 1 ms 3596 KiB
01_random_03.txt WA 100 ms 11284 KiB
01_random_04.txt WA 101 ms 11304 KiB
01_random_05.txt WA 101 ms 11380 KiB
01_random_06.txt WA 100 ms 11380 KiB
01_random_07.txt WA 100 ms 11140 KiB
01_random_08.txt WA 100 ms 11260 KiB
01_random_09.txt WA 100 ms 11276 KiB
01_random_10.txt WA 101 ms 11404 KiB
01_random_11.txt WA 15 ms 4720 KiB
01_random_12.txt WA 98 ms 11124 KiB
01_random_13.txt WA 87 ms 10364 KiB
01_random_14.txt AC 99 ms 11264 KiB
01_random_15.txt AC 100 ms 11380 KiB
01_random_16.txt AC 101 ms 11260 KiB
01_random_17.txt WA 100 ms 11356 KiB
01_random_18.txt WA 100 ms 11452 KiB
01_random_19.txt WA 99 ms 11284 KiB
01_random_20.txt WA 100 ms 11212 KiB
01_random_21.txt WA 100 ms 11376 KiB
01_random_22.txt WA 101 ms 11132 KiB
01_random_23.txt AC 72 ms 9228 KiB
01_random_24.txt AC 27 ms 5708 KiB
01_random_25.txt WA 99 ms 11140 KiB
01_random_26.txt WA 30 ms 5884 KiB
01_random_27.txt WA 74 ms 9212 KiB
01_random_28.txt WA 17 ms 4740 KiB
01_random_29.txt AC 1 ms 3404 KiB
01_random_30.txt AC 1 ms 3476 KiB
01_random_31.txt AC 1 ms 3476 KiB
01_random_32.txt AC 1 ms 3572 KiB
01_random_33.txt AC 1 ms 3580 KiB
01_random_34.txt AC 1 ms 3580 KiB
01_random_35.txt AC 1 ms 3568 KiB
01_random_36.txt AC 1 ms 3476 KiB
01_random_37.txt AC 1 ms 3572 KiB
01_random_38.txt AC 100 ms 11408 KiB
01_random_39.txt AC 100 ms 11276 KiB
01_random_40.txt WA 100 ms 11284 KiB
01_random_41.txt WA 99 ms 11404 KiB